RECOMMENDATION

Take the following actions regarding the Mental Health Basement Abatement Project, Contract No. 610446A: (1) Find the project categorically exempt in conformance with the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) Section 15301, Class 1-Existing Facilities; (2) approve plans and specifications and direct the Public Works Director to advertise for bids; and (3) authorize opening of bids on or after April 4, 2017 at 11 a.m.

SUMMARY

An abatement project is proposed in preparation for a remodel of the Mental Health Building basement.

DISCUSSION

The Mental Health Building is located at 2640 Breslauer Way. This building is the old Shasta General Hospital.  The kitchen and cafeteria were in the basement. A remodel is proposed to create offices, break room, meeting room, restrooms and ADA compliant parking. Health and Human Services Agency (HHSA) program staff and supervisors would occupy the space. An abatement project is proposed to remove asbestos and lead.  Tenant improvements will be proposed under a subsequent contract.

FINANCING

The total cost of the Mental Health Basement Remodel Project which includes the abatement is estimated to be $1,200,000. There is $50,000 budgeted in LB&I for FY 2016/17. Additional appropriations will be proposed at time of award or in conjunction with the FY 2017/18 budget. There is no additional General Fund impact.
